Nuova Simonelli Oscar II Competition DNA for the Home Barista

A compact single-group heat exchanger machine that brews and steams at once — built by the company behind the World Barista Championship machine.

The Nuova Simonelli Oscar II is one of the most distinctive heat exchanger espresso machines in the prosumer market. Engineered in Belforte del Chienti, Italy, it pairs a 2-litre copper heat exchanger boiler, a commercial 58mm group head, a thermo-compensated brew group, and an ergonomic push-pull steam lever in a stainless steel and ABS body around 32cm wide. The result is simultaneous brewing and steaming at a price point that makes it one of the best-value HX machines in Australia.

The Oscar II is built for the home barista who has outgrown entry-level machines and wants real steaming power, a stable thermosiphon brew path, and the tactile feedback of professional-grade hardware. With Nuova Simonelli's commercial heritage built into every component, it consistently performs above its price tier.

Heat Exchanger Technology — Brew and Steam Without Compromise

Unlike a single-boiler machine that forces you to wait and switch between brewing and steaming, the Oscar II's heat exchanger keeps steam pressure constant while delivering brew-ready water to the group head independently. For anyone making milk-based drinks, that means no stop-start workflow — pull your shot and texture milk in one continuous motion.

The brew group is Nuova Simonelli's compact thermosiphon ring group, not an E61. It locks a 58mm portafilter and circulates hot water through the heat exchanger loop to hold a consistent brew temperature, without the long soak-heavy warm-up that E61 groups demand. As with most HX machines, a brief flush of the group after a long idle clears superheated water and brings brew temperature into the ideal range.

Full Specifications

Machine Type Single group, heat exchanger espresso machine
Boiler System Heat exchanger — 2-litre copper boiler
Boiler Capacity 2 litres
Pump Type Vibratory pump
Group Head 58mm commercial portafilter — thermo-compensated ring group
Dosing Timed volumetric — programmable single and double buttons
Water Supply 3-litre removable reservoir (Pour Over) or direct plumb variant
Steam & Brew Simultaneous — HX system
Steam Wand High-capacity wand, 360° swivel — ergonomic push-pull steam lever
Solenoid Valve 3-way — dry puck after every shot
Construction Stainless steel and ABS body — made in Italy
Origin Italy — Nuova Simonelli, Belforte del Chienti
Dimensions 300 × 400 × 408mm (W×H×D) — approx. 32cm-wide footprint
Net Weight 13kg
Power 1200W
Power Supply 230V / 50Hz (Australian spec)

Common Questions

What is the difference between the Oscar II and the original Oscar?

The Oscar II is a substantial redesign of the original, with a new stainless steel and ABS body, an ergonomic push-pull steam lever in place of the older steam knob, improved timed-dosing controls, and a refined thermo-compensated brew group. It retains the heat exchanger boiler and 58mm commercial group, but improves steaming ergonomics, build quality, and everyday usability.

Does the Oscar II use a rotary or vibratory pump?

The Oscar II uses a vibratory pump, which is standard for heat exchanger machines at this price point. It ramps cleanly and delivers the high pressure needed for espresso extraction. Paired with the ring group's pre-infusion geometry, it gives a gentle, consistent start to each shot.

Can the Oscar II be used in a small café or office?

Yes. The HX boiler and optional direct-plumb variant make it suitable for low-to-moderate volume office and light café environments. Its compact 32cm-wide footprint makes it popular in specialty roaster showrooms, co-working spaces, and home offices where a full commercial machine isn't practical.

Does the Oscar II require flushing before pulling a shot?

Like most HX machines, the Oscar II benefits from a short flush of the group head if it has been idle for a while. This clears superheated water from the heat exchanger loop and brings the brew temperature into the optimal range. A brief flush after long idle periods is good practice for consistent extraction.
